If a previous owner (or you) had hacked up/cut up the metal dash in your Beetle to put a DIN radio and you now want to put the stock radio back, you will find that the cut up /hacked up hole is too big and the stock radio does not cover the hole. This little bracket fixes that issue. You can paint it the same color as your dash and the stock radio fits perfectly. It has tabs on top and bottom that hold it firmly in place in the hacked up hole. You don't need to weld in any replacement radio hole sheet metal to fix your dash. Print with flat faceplate side down and with supports. The four tabs that hold the bracket in the hole need supports. They are about 1.5mm above the faceplate to accommodate the dash metal. I printed mine at 100% infill and with PTEG. PLA will not be able to take the heat inside the car.
